I had a lot of fun with this book. 

If you liked Greenglass House, you're most likely going to like this as well, though they are different. 

This follows our main protagonist Elizabeth after she's sent to Winterhouse for the winter holidays so her aunt and uncle can go on their own vacation. Elizabeth is full of curiosity and loves to solve puzzles and sometimes all of that gets her into trouble. When she arrives at Winterhouse she begins to discover the mysteries it offers and things go from there. 

I loved the mystery aspect of this book, the setting was also great, but the characters are where this book shone. I really enjoyed Elizabeth's character, but I think my favorite is Freddy - he's just so relatable to me. The pacing is where some of the problems of this book came about and particularly towards the end. I will say that even though I loved the mystery aspect, I saw all of it from a mile away, but given that I'm not the intended audience, that's ok. 

All in all a fun read and I look forward to picking up book two.
